On the Synthesis of an Asynchronous Reactive Module

نویسندگان

  • Amir Pnueli
  • Roni Rosner
چکیده

We consider the synthesis of a reactive asynchronous module which communicates with its environment via the shared input variable z and the shared output variable y, assuming that the module is specified by the linear temporal formula p(x, y). We derive from ~(x, y) another linear formula X(r, w, z, y), with the additional scheduling variables r, w, and show that there exists a program satisfying ~ iff the branching time formula (Yr, w, x)(3y)AX(r, w, x, y) is valid over all tree models. For the restricted case that all variables range over finite domains, the validity problem is decidable, and we present an algorithm, of doubly exponential time and space complexity, for constructing a program that implements the specification whenever it is implementable. In addition, we provide some matching lower bounds.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A hybrid agent model: a reactive and cognitive behavior

To model complex systems, software agents need to combine cognitive abilities to reason about complex situations, and reactive abilities to meet hard deadlines. We propose an operational hybrid agent model which mixes well known paradigms (objects, actors, production rules and ATN) and real-time performances. This agent model combines cognitive and reactive modules. The cognitive module uses a ...

متن کامل

The Effect of Asynchronous versus Computer-mediated Corrective Feedback on the Correct Use of English Articles in an EFL Context

 The purpose of this study is to investigate the effects of asynchronous computer-mediated versus conventional corrective feedback on learners' writing accuracy. Three groups of learners took part in the study: asynchronous feedback group, conventional feedback group, and a control group. Asynchronous feedback group students received explicit feedback on the targeted structure via e-mail, while...

متن کامل

Module-based Synthesis of Behavioral Verilog Descriptions to Asynchronous Circuits

In this paper we present a design tool for automatic synthesis of Verilog behavioral description of an asynchronous circuit into delay insensitive presynthesized library modules, using syntax directed techniques. Our design tool can also generate appropriate output to support implementing the circuit on ASICs and LUT-based FPGAs consequently rapid prototyping of the asynchronous circuit becomes...

متن کامل

The Impact of the Asynchronous Online Discussion Forum on the Iranian EFL Students’ Writing Ability and Attitudes

This paper focuses on the impact of an asynchronous online discussion forum on the development of students’ ability in and attitudes toward writing in English. To do this, 60 undergraduate students majoring in English were assigned to two experimental and control groups while receiving different types of feedback. Students in the experimental group were required to take part in an asynchronous ...

متن کامل

Asynchronous Online Discussion Forum: A Key to Enhancing Students’ Writing Ability and Attitudes in Iran

This paper focuses on the impact of an asynchronous online discussion forum on the development of students’ ability in and attitudes toward writing in English. Two groups of third-year students (N = 60) majoring in English were assigned to two treatment and control groups, each receiving different types of feedback. Students in the treatment group were required to participate 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1989